**Responsibilities and Impact:**
This is a hybrid role spanning sales support and sales development activities across our team of salespeople in the Americas region.
You’ll be supporting the Americas LS Sales teams by providing ground support to help drive revenue retention and acquisition across S&P Market Intelligence's Lending Solutions product lines to help us achieve and exceed business goals.
You will engage with new prospects and existing clients, work with our specialists and the legal team to draft contracts and will be using a full suite of tools to develop our pipeline and support growth.
Based in New York, this role requires close interaction with management and individuals across three sales teams. You’ll be collaborating with surrounding groups such as account management, legal, marketing, sales ops, SDR and product teams across the firm in what is a varied and challenging role.
Alongside prospecting, you will have close interactions with the existing customer base to maintain relationships and existing revenue as well as identifying and supporting upsell opportunities, fully supported by our expert sales teams.
+ Support the sales team with drafting contracts for new opportunities and renewals
+ Assist management with Salesforce queries and reporting
+ Intensive on-line research while identifying key decision makers from global financial institutions
+ Conduct outbound / cold call & cold on-line engagements and develop leads / prospects and pass to the sales team as well as speaking with prospects who have attended events / requested information
+ Be creative and implement activities to contact new customers and generate new business
+ Accurately track leads & activities (calls, emails, meetings) using CRM
+ Take responsibility in centralizing and coordinating the update and maintenance of sales materials across the regional sales teams
+ Produce periodic status and engagement reports
+ Ensure handoffs to sales are successful and exceed customer expectations
+ Qualify incoming queries and prospects
**Compensation/Benefits Information:** (This section is only applicable to US candidates)
S&P Global states that the anticipated base salary range for this position is $59,212 to $92,000. Final base salary for this role will be based on the individual’s geographic location, as well as experience level, skill set, training, licenses and certifications.
In addition to base compensation, this role is eligible for an annual incentive bonus.
